Conducting a Patent Search

Tips for searching patents (1976-present)
  1. Go to the U.S. Patent Search Page.
  2. Choose Quick Search.
  3. Enter appropriate search terms.
  4. View information about the patent by clicking on its title or number.
  5. Click on Images to view the patent
  6. Tips:
      .
    • Note: Patents before 1976 are not searchable by keywords
    • Note classification numbers of patents that are close to what you are looking for - this will be useful for older patents. These are listed next to Current U.S. Class

Tips for searching patents (pre 1976)
  1. Pre 1976 patents are only searchable via patent number and class.
  2. Use the previous directions to find similar patents and use the class numbers to search for older patents.
  3. You can also view information about class numbers online.
  4. You can browse class numbers by topic (click on the white P in a red rectangle).
